深入解析英文站源码:获取、分析与应用 文章
随着互联网的飞速发展,英文网站在全球范围内拥有庞大的用户群体。对于开发者而言,掌握英文站源码的获取、分析和应用技巧,不仅能够提升技术能力,还能为个人或企业带来更多的商业机会。本文将深入解析英文站源码,从获取、分析到应用三个方面进行详细阐述。
一、英文站源码的获取
1.手动获取
(1)使用开发者工具
在浏览器中,我们可以通过开发者工具来查看英文站的源码。以Chrome为例,按下F12键进入开发者工具,点击“网络”标签页,在左侧找到对应的页面,点击“查看元素”或“源码”即可查看源码。
(2)直接查看网页源码
在浏览器地址栏中输入“Ctrl+U”(Windows)或“Cmd+Option+I”(Mac),即可查看当前网页的源码。
2.使用自动化工具获取
(1)XPath、CSS选择器
XPath和CSS选择器是两种常用的网页元素定位方法。通过编写相应的XPath或CSS选择器,我们可以快速定位到目标元素,并获取其源码。
(2)网络爬虫
网络爬虫是一种自动化获取网页内容的技术。Python、Java等编程语言都提供了丰富的网络爬虫库,如Scrapy、BeautifulSoup等。通过编写爬虫程序,我们可以实现大规模的英文站源码获取。
二、英文站源码的分析
1.结构分析
英文站源码的结构通常包括HTML、CSS和JavaScript三个部分。通过分析这三个部分,我们可以了解网站的整体布局和功能实现。
(1)HTML:主要负责网页的结构和内容展示。
(2)CSS:主要负责网页的样式设计。
(3)JavaScript:主要负责网页的动态效果和交互功能。
2.功能分析
通过分析英文站源码,我们可以了解网站的主要功能模块和实现方式。例如,登录、注册、搜索、购物车等功能模块,以及它们在源码中的具体实现。
3.技术分析
英文站源码中可能涉及到多种技术,如前端框架、后端语言、数据库等。通过对源码的分析,我们可以了解网站所使用的技术栈,为后续的优化和改进提供参考。
三、英文站源码的应用
1.网站优化
通过对英文站源码的分析,我们可以发现网站在性能、用户体验等方面存在的问题,并提出相应的优化方案。例如,优化网页加载速度、提高页面响应速度、提升用户体验等。
2.技术研究
英文站源码为我们提供了丰富的技术参考。我们可以通过研究源码,学习到前端、后端、数据库等技术的应用方法,提升自己的技术能力。
3.模块化开发
将英文站源码中的优秀模块提取出来,进行模块化开发,可以节省开发时间和成本。例如,将常用的UI组件、功能模块等封装成插件,方便其他项目复用。
4.创意设计
英文站源码中的设计元素和布局思路,可以为我们提供丰富的创意灵感。通过对源码的研究,我们可以借鉴其设计理念,为自己的项目带来新颖的设计效果。
总结
英文站源码的获取、分析和应用,对于开发者来说具有重要的意义。掌握相关技巧,可以帮助我们更好地了解互联网技术,提升个人技术能力,为企业创造更多价值。在今后的工作中,我们要不断学习、实践,不断提高自己在英文站源码领域的应用能力。